| 0:26.3 | New Yorkers made history by electing Zohran Mamdani as mayor of America's largest metropolis. |
| 0:33.7 | New York, tonight you have delivered a mandate for change. |
| 0:39.7 | He'll be the first Muslim for South Asian and the youngest person to lead New York City in over a century. |
| 0:44.9 | Despite a campaign against him laced with anti-Muslim bigotry, voters chose his message of affordability. |
| 0:50.9 | And Californians approved a new congressional map that could give Democrats up to five more House seats in next year's midterms. |
